7. Chassis intrusion connector (4-1 pin CHASSIS) This connector is for a chassis-mounted intrusion detection sensor or switch. Connect one end of the chassis intrusion sensor or switch cable to this connector. The chassis intrusion sensor or switch sends a high-level signal to this connector when a chassis component is removed or replaced. The signal is then generated as a chassis intrusion event. By default, the pins labeled "Chassis Signal" and "Ground" are shorted with a jumper cap. Power connectors (24-pin EATXPWR, 8-pin EATX12V, 4-pin EZ_PLUG1) These connectors are for ATX power supply plugs. The power supply plugs are designed to fit these connectors in only one orientation.
